A view of Liverpool

Day trip from Wigan to Liverpool by bus

Why visit Liverpool for the day?

Liverpool is known for The Beatles, football and a waterfront shaped by its maritime past. Its grand docks, museums and lively city centre give it a proud, creative character.

How to get from Wigan to Liverpool by bus?

The earliest coach runs at 00:14, the last at 23:39. The fastest coach covers the 27 km distance in 1h 33m.

A view of Manchester

Day trip from Wigan to Manchester by bus

Why visit Manchester for the day?

Manchester is known for its industrial heritage, influential music and deep football culture. Red-brick canalside areas, major museums and lively nightlife give it an energetic northern character.

How to get from Wigan to Manchester by bus?

The earliest coach runs at 03:40, the last at 23:55. The fastest coach covers the 27 km distance in 1h 19m.

A view of Chester

Day trip from Wigan to Chester by bus

Why visit Chester for the day?

Chester is known for its Roman walls, medieval streets and the distinctive black-and-white Rows. Compact and walkable, it blends deep history with a relaxed riverside setting and a lively city centre.

How to get from Wigan to Chester by bus?

The earliest coach runs at 04:48, the last at 22:00. The fastest coach covers the 43 km distance in 2h 17m.

A view of Blackpool

Day trip from Wigan to Blackpool by bus

Why visit Blackpool for the day?

Blackpool is a classic Lancashire seaside resort known for its piers, ballroom heritage and the Blackpool Illuminations. The long promenade and Blackpool Tower give the town a lively, traditional holiday feel.

How to get from Wigan to Blackpool by bus?

The earliest coach runs at 00:05, the last at 23:56. The fastest coach covers the 41 km distance in 1h 50m.

A view of Preston

Day trip from Wigan to Preston by bus

Why visit Preston for the day?

Preston is a Lancashire city known for its industrial heritage, lively student population and the Harris Museum. Its centre blends Victorian character with modern shops and cafés, while riverside parks soften the urban feel.

How to get from Wigan to Preston by bus?

There are 4 coaches per day. The earliest coach runs at 00:10, the last at 23:54. The fastest coach covers the 25 km distance in 1h 21m.

How to Get to Wigan by Bus

Wigan, a historic Celtic town situated in Greater Manchester, is easily accessible from all over the UK. Wigan has committed to improving its public transport system since 2013 after the bus business was acquired by Stagecoach which runs the commercial services. This major bus operator provides hourly services arriving and departing from Wigan and the surrounding local areas to Hindley, Pemberton and Leigh. To increase its travel routes, Stagecoach also offers services to larger cities such as Manchester. Long distance coach services such as National Express also operate in this bus station, ensuring the town is connected to other major cities such as London Victoria, Birmingham and Bristol.

Wigan

Wigan is a beautiful town seeped in history and there are great opportunities to visit its numerous heritage sites. At the Museum of Wigan Life you can learn more about the historic past of the area and visit the Trencherfield Mill Steam Engine which built 100 years ago, is a fine operating example of local industrial engineering. Wigan is also rich in culture and you can delve into its arts scene at the Turnpike Gallery which inspires through interesting exhibitions and visual arts or you can enjoy a range of cultural festivals on throughout the year such as the Wigan Food and Drink Festival, International Jazz Festival and Words Festival. Wigan is also the centre of Greenheart, a stretch of beautiful parks and majestic woodlands which are the ideal setting for a leisurely stroll. If it's shopping you prefer, Wigan town centre is a hub of major chain stores and independent retailers, while The Grande Arcade is a premier shopping centre for a more indulgent shopping spree.

FlixBus

About
FlixBus is one of Europe’s leading low-cost bus companies, founded in Germany and now offering long-distance services across Europe and the United States. In addition to its extensive daytime network, FlixBus also operates overnight buses on select European routes. Standard amenities include free Wi-Fi, power outlets to charge devices, extra legroom, luggage space, and onboard toilets, with snacks and drinks available for purchase. FlixBus offers a single Standard ticket type for all routes, which includes one carry-on bag and one checked bag per passenger. Additional fees apply for extra luggage and for reserving specific seats, such as Extra Seats, Table Seats, or Panorama Seats. This combination of affordability, comfort, and wide coverage makes FlixBus a popular choice for budget-conscious travelers.

National Express

About
National Express is the UK’s leading long-distance coach company, operating over 550 services per day and serving more than 900 destinations nationwide. It also runs frequent services to major UK airports — including Heathrow, Gatwick, Stansted, Luton, and Bristol — 24 hours a day. All National Express coaches are air-conditioned and offer free Wi-Fi and onboard entertainment. Most vehicles are equipped with seat belts and power outlets at every seat, allowing you to charge your phone or laptop during your journey. Ticket options include Restricted Fare, Standard Fare, and Fully Flexible Fare, with the latter providing maximum flexibility for cancellations or changes.

Tipping culture

Tipping is optional. In restaurants, 10-12.5% is usual for good service if not already added. Taxi fares can be rounded up. In cafés, small change is appreciated but not expected.
